NEW YORK (PIX11) – Sunday is the last day to apply for New York City's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her program.

You can apply until 11:59 p.m. Once applications close, 200,000 applicants will be randomly selected to join the program’s waitlist through a lottery.

Families in the program are given a voucher when they search for housing, which allows them to pay no more than 40% of their monthly income toward rent. NYCHA then pays the rest of the rent on the family’s behalf.

You can apply for the program regardless of whether you live in NYCHA housing or not. The voucher only applies to housing on the private market.

Your household’s gross income must also be under the area median income. For a household of three, it's $69,900 per year.

For a household of one, the income is $54,350 per year. To see more requirements for the Section 8 application, including age requirements, click here.

Applicants will be notified when the waitlist is created. Each application is reviewed by NYCHA, and you can check the status of your application by checking out NYCHA's Self Service Portal.

It's not guaranteed that everyone who applies to the Section 8 program will get a spot on the waitlist, according to NYCHA. The people who do get added to the waitlist will then be interviewed by NYCHA to make sure they meet Section 8 requirements.

NYCHA received more than 400,000 applications for the program as of Wednesday. The waitlist has been closed since 2009.

NYCHA anticipates that a waitlist will be created by Aug. 1.
